The Pune Porsche case is about a 17-year-old boy from a wealthy real estate family who is accused of killing two people in a Porsche accident
The controversy surrounding the case is about the allegations of preferential treatment given to the boy due to his family's influence
The Agrawal family has a legacy in real estate dating back four decades with Bramhadutt Agrawal laying the foundation for Bramha Corp
The police investigation is ongoing with the boy's father and five others arrested in connection with the case
The case has raised important questions about the influence of power and privilege in the justice system highlighting the need for a fair and impartial investigation
